Hotels in Paris achieved the highest revenue per available room (revpar) in October of the 10 European cities listed in the monthly Europe HotStats survey.
Revpar in Parisian hotels grew by 17.9% to €186.79
London hotels achieved the second highest revpar, which rose by 15.6% to €167.30. However, the biggest rise occurred in Moscow, which boosted repvar by 26.9% to €161.62 to take third position.
Prague was the only city were revpar dipped (by 1.3%) but Amsterdam turned in the second worst performance with a 0.5% increase.
The figures are compiled each month by Tri Hospitality Consulting.

Definition of terms
Occupancy is that proportion of the bedrooms available during the period which are occupied during the period.
Room rate is the total bedroom revenue for the period divided by the total bedrooms occupied during the period.
Revpar is the total bedroom revenue for the period divided by the total available rooms during the period
Payroll% is the payroll for all hotels in the sample as a percentage of total revenue
IBFCpar is the Income Before Fixed Charges shown per available room
